What Are Exosomes?
Exosomes are small extracellular vesicles that play a crucial role in cell communication. They contain proteins, lipids, and RNA transferred between cells to regulate various biological processes, including tissue repair. In skin regeneration, exosomes help by facilitating the delivery of growth factors and other regenerative molecules to damaged skin, accelerating healing.

By promoting the repair of damaged tissues, exosomes enhance skin rejuvenation, boost collagen synthesis, and improve skin elasticity, making them a valuable tool in dermatological treatments to restore youthful skin.
Synergistic Effects of Polynucleotides and Exosomes
Polynucleotides and exosomes work synergistically to enhance skin regeneration. Polynucleotides promote cellular repair and hydration, while exosomes improve cellular communication, stimulating collagen production and tissue regeneration. This combination accelerates healing, restores skin elasticity, and improves skin tone.
Together, they provide more effective and long-lasting results than when used individually. They address signs of aging and promote healthier, more youthful-looking skin. The combined approach offers enhanced rejuvenation, supporting immediate and ongoing skin improvements.

Patient Selection
Patient selection is key for achieving optimal results when considering polynucleotides and exosomes for skin regeneration. Here’s a list of factors to consider:
- Signs of Aging: Ideal for those with wrinkles, fine lines, and loss of skin elasticity.
- Scarring: Effective for patients with acne scars or other types of scarring.
- Pigmentation Issues: Beneficial for treating uneven skin tone or hyperpigmentation.
- Compromised Skin Integrity: Helps improve overall skin health and appearance.
- Active Skin Infections: Not recommended for patients with active infections.
- Autoimmune Conditions: Should be avoided by individuals with certain autoimmune disorders.
A consultation with a dermatologist is important to assess your skin’s unique needs and customize treatments for the best results. FAQs
1. What are polynucleotides?
Polynucleotides are long chains of nucleotides, the building blocks of DNA and RNA. They play a crucial role in cellular functions like repair, replication, and regeneration.
2. How do polynucleotides benefit the skin?
Polynucleotides help stimulate collagen production, repair cellular damage, and provide deep hydration, contributing to healthier, more youthful-looking skin.
3. Are polynucleotides safe for the skin?
Yes, polynucleotides are generally safe for skin use, especially in controlled dermatological treatments. They are biocompatible and rarely cause adverse reactions.
4. What skin concerns can polynucleotides address?
Polynucleotides are effective for treating fine lines, wrinkles, sun damage, scars, and signs of aging by promoting skin regeneration and improving skin elasticity.
